The former Buckeye stands a whopping 6’8' and 375 pounds.

Those measurements make me wonder why the Seahawks are bringing him in for a Top-30 visit. I mean, I see the appeal, but . . .And I can’t imagine the Seahawks are thinking about asking this mountain of a man to play Guard.

Of course, bringing a player in for a visit is a lot different than drafting them, but with only 30 visits allowed, it seems strange to just “burn” one, especially the first one, on a player that you have no intention of drafting. Which makes me think that the Seahawks’ brain trust might be thinking outside the box a little bit and that maybe the thought is that Abe Lucas would move to guard if Dawand Jones joins the Seahawks on Draft Day.

Granted, Abe Lucas isn’t a small man either. He stands 6-foot-7 and weighs 315 pounds. But he’s a bit of a runt compared to Jones.Jones is an absolute mauler in the run game. He’s a massive and powerful blocker that blasts open running lanes and he can be overwhelming for opponents in college. Jones engulfs opponents as a run blocker and puts them on skates. He has ideal block temperament, aggression, and tenacity.

Jones’ overwhelming size has some drawbacks, but he’s not a liability from a mobility standpoint. He has good foot speed for his size and can quickly transfer weight on shuffles and carry rushers to the apex. He also flashes good burst off the snap and can loom through gaps with decent speed as a lateral mover.Jones is a massive man with outstanding length to control the line of scrimmage. He really uses his awareness and instincts to gain advantages while his eyes work to keep him aware.
